At the end of the day, I agree that Capcom painted themselves into a corner with the idea of Bison snatching bodies, etc. It makes him seem invincible, unfortunately they need an outside agency that is presented to be OBVIOUSLY more powerful.
That’s your mistake.
The villain of the piece should seem invincible and be the most powerful force. That is what makes the damn struggle of the story worth it. If we know that Ingrid can just swoop in at any time and render Bison irrelevant it undermines the entire struggle of the actual main characters against him.
It’s awful writing. In fact, it flies in the face of basic writing structure all-together.
Superman isn’t in Gotham because he would make the Joker’s threat irrelevant.
Ingrid is Superman.
She is useless to the conflict of SF as she currently exists.
